April’s event will give you a sneak peek of FedGeoDay 2026!

GeoDC’s guest speakers for the evening will be members of the organizing team for FedGeoDay, a conference about how federal programs and stakeholders build, support and use geospatial open-source software, open data, open science and open mapping.

FedGeoDay 2026: Building Ecosystems for Supporting Federal Data Stewardship
Do you use US Census data, NASA satellite imagery or federal GIS tools? Curious how policy changes and AI innovation are shaping the way we think/talk about or solve problems with location and maps? FedGeoDay 2026, a conference on April 22–23 in the DC area, will answer these questions and more.

FedGeoDay is the premier conference devoted to how federal programs and stakeholders cultivate and harness “open geospatial ecosystems.” Themed Building Ecosystems for Supporting Federal Data Stewardship, FedGeoDay 2026 will feature more content than ever and more ways for attendees to engage and shape the dialogue.

Organizing team members including Eddie Pickle from Snowflake will answer your questions and tell you more about the conference, including the hands-on workshops on day two and the first-ever FedGeoDay "unconference," which gives the power to shape the discussion back to the attendees in the spirit of open source. FedGeoDay's planning team also includes GeoDC's very own Chad Blevins and Puneet Kollipara.

FedGeoDay is April 22–23 in Suitland, MD at the Census Bureau HQ, just off the Green Line. Check out the website for an at-a-glance view of the program, keynoted by Denice Ross (former U.S. Chief Data Scientist, now at Federation of American Scientists).
